虚拟TP钱包转错账的全局分析:从TLS、合约审计到WASM与账户恢复

引言:

虚拟TP钱包发生转错账(向错误地址或合约发送资产)是区块链与数字支付世界常见但复杂的问题。处理不仅涉及链上技术(合约、WASM执行环境、交易回滚能力),也涉及链下运维与法务(TLS连接、市场情报、跨境支付与合规)。本文从技术、审计、市场与恢复策略全面探讨应对路径与最佳实践。

一、成因概览与即时处置

常见成因包括:用户输错地址、钓鱼域名/假UI、合约逻辑缺陷、第三方服务(托管、桥接)错误、或中间件遭受中间人攻击。遭遇转错账后应立即:1) 在区块浏览器查证交易哈希、目标地址与合约;2) 暂停相关账户或合约(若具管理权限);3) 联系对方链上地址背后服务、托管方或交易所;4) 收集证据并向安全团队/监管机构报备。

二、TLS协议的角色

TLS协议是保护钱包与服务端(节点、RPC、钱包供应商、交易所)通信安全的第一道防线。正确配置并强制使用TLS可以防止中间人篡改、钓鱼脚本注入或私钥泄露的传输阶段攻击。必须注意:

- 强制HTTPS并验证证书链与主机名;

- 使用HSTS、证书钉扎或公钥透明度(CT)以降低假证书风险;

- 定期更新TLS库以避免已知漏洞(如心脏出血类历史问题)。

TLS并不能防止链上错误逻辑,但能阻断很多因通信被劫持引起的错误转账。

三、合约审计的重要性与局限

合约审计能在部署前发现重入、权限错误、边界条件与整数溢出等问题,减少“转错账”由合约逻辑引发的损失。审计要点包括:权限最小化、紧急停止(circuit breaker)、事件日志完整性、输入校验、回退与异常处理。

审计局限在于:审计不是形式化证明,审计质量依赖审计者经验与测试覆盖;WASM合约或新语言生态下漏洞样式可能不同,需找熟悉目标VM(如CosmWasm、WASM-VM)的审计团队。

四、WASM(WebAssembly)合约的机遇与风险

WASM为智能合约带来多语言支持与高性能,但也引入了新的安全考量:内存安全、ABI兼容、沙箱逃逸风险及语言级别未定义行为。针对WASM合约:

- 使用成熟的运行时与沙箱策略;

- 做模糊测试(fuzzing)、符号执行与白盒测试;

- 关注第三方库依赖与编译器后端的安全性。

五、市场动态报告(情报)如何辅助应对

实时的市场动态报告能帮助发现大规模误转或攻击模式:异常提现潮、流动性突然消失、某类合约被重复攻击等。安全团队应结合链上监控告警、OSINT与交易所通知制定快速响应机制。市场报告也利于评估追回可能性与成本,决定是否通过谈判或司法途径追索。

六、全球化数字支付与跨境追回难题

数字资产跨境流动便利但为追回带来挑战:司法管辖权不同、KYC/AML规则差异、交易所配合程度不一。对于误转到中心化交易所的资产,通常通过法律路径和合规请求(冻结账户、出示证据)追回概率较高;若资产进入自托管地址或匿名混合器,技术与法律难度显著增加。

七、账户恢复与弥补机制

针对私钥丢失或误转的恢复策略包括:

- 多签与时间锁:将关键操作放在多签合约并加入延时,提供撤销窗口;

- 社会恢复(Guardians):预先指定可信联系人或服务在触发时协助恢复;

- 密钥分片(Shamir)与阈值签名:将密钥分散存储,降低单点丢失风险;

- 托管+保险:将部分资产交给受监管托管方,并购买保险;

- 法律与仲裁:在设计合约时嵌入仲裁/升级路径以应对极端事故(需谨慎以免集中化)。

八、建议与最佳实践清单

- 使用硬件钱包、地址簿与ENS类可读名避免手动输入地址;

- 部署合约前进行充分审计、模糊测试与形式化检查重点函数;

- 对外服务强制TLS并启用证书钉扎与及时更新;

- 为关键合约引入暂停开关、多签与时间锁;

- 建立链上监控与市场情报订阅,快速察觉异常;

- 设计并测试账户恢复流程(社会恢复、多签恢复);

- 在跨境追回前准备好链上证据、日志和KYC请求清单以提高与交易所或监管机构沟通效率。

结语:

虚拟TP钱包转错账既是技术问题也是治理问题。通过强化TLS等通信安全、严格合约审计、针对WASM的特定测试、利用市场情报以及构建多层次的账户恢复机制,可以显著降低事故发生概率并提升事后可控性。体系化的安全设计与跨域协作是减少转错账损失的关键。

作者:林海辰发布时间:2026-02-05 04:31:54

评论

Crypto小白

文章很全面,尤其是把TLS和WASM放在一起讨论,提醒我还没给钱包强制开启硬件签名。

Jade88

关于市场动态报告那段很实用,看来要订阅更多链上警报服务来防范批量误转。

链安老赵

建议补充一点:对接交易所时应保留完整RPC与请求日志,这对司法取证很关键。

Neo用户

社会恢复和多签的对比写得清晰。实践中两者结合更灵活,也更安全。

相关阅读